ITAC-administered grants for Indigenous-owned tourism businesses: market readiness, marketing development, and product enhancement. Multiple streams ranging from $5,000 to $25,000.

The estimated value is Up to $25,000 per stream. The actual amount depends on your eligible costs, the program's budget, and approval.
1. Become an ITAC member if not already 2. Identify the most relevant grant stream 3. Submit proposal during open intake
Competitive intakes that open and close; the Micro and Small Business Stream is currently closed. Watch the ITAC Programs & Services page and the federal SITES page for open windows..
